Carrer de Can Campaner, 6

07003 Mallorca - Palma de Mallorca - España

Contact us if you have any questions or would like more information about the hotel and its facilities. We will happily answer your questions via our online web form, phone, social media, or email.


Reception hours

from Monday to Sunday

24 hours

GPS coordinates

Latitude: 39.57207981639773

Longitude 2.6494833511021287

Social networks